Transaction 62b5ddeed6a5185c6fd890d4cba44b8a71cd11c2f890fd2bd371ad7195c2a8b5
1 Input
1 Output
-
62b5ddeed6a5185c6fd890d4cba44b8a71cd11c2f890fd2bd371ad7195c2a8b5:0
- value
- 325894
- script pubkey
- OP_0 OP_PUSHBYTES_20 c18725fd4b2dc7f0416c90241c1aa439a43eb904
- address
- bc1qcxrjtl2t9hrlqstvjqjpcx4y8xjrawgyqt8xdv